mw-150 dihydrochloride dihydrate
T54871661020-92-3
MW-150 dihydrochloride dihydrate (MW01-18-150SRM dihydrochloride dihydrate) is a selective, CNS-penetrant, and orally active p38α MAPK inhibitor with a Ki of 101 nM. It inhibits the endogenous p38α MAPK's ability to phosphorylate the endogenous substrate MK2 in activated glia [1].

Hyaluronic acid Methacryloyl (MW 150 kDa)
HAMA (MW 150 kDa)
T89015
Hyaluronic Acid Methacryloyl (HAMA) with a molecular weight of 150 kDa is a biocompatible methacrylated derivative of hyaluronic acid. HAMA is utilized as an ink for 3D printing hydrogels, exhibiting rapid photoreactive responses, quick gelation speeds, and stable hydrogel properties. Under ultraviolet light exposure, HAMA efficiently induces gelation in conjunction with phenyl-2,4,6-trimethylbenzoylphosphinate (LAP). The integration of HAMA with tissue-specific extracellular matrix (ECM) materials, such as pancreatic ECM (pECM), is poised to become a vital source material for organ-like tissue cultivation.

MW-150 hydrochloride
MW-150 hydrochloride, MW01-18-150SRM hydrochloride
T393431923773-01-6
MW-150 hydrochloride (MW01-18-150SRM hydrochloride) is a potent and selective inhibitor of p38α MAPK with a Ki value of 101 nM. It exhibits excellent CNS penetration and oral bioavailability, and effectively suppresses the phosphorylation of MK2, a substrate of endogenous p38α MAPK, in activated glial cells.

TRITC-dextran (MW 150000)
TRITC-dextran (MW 150000), Tetramethyl rhodamine isothiocyanate glucan, MW 150000
TXB-00586
TRITC-dextran MW 150000 is a fluorescent dye with a molecular weight of 150 kD. It has an excitation wavelength of 555 nm. This compound is utilized in drug delivery systems due to its stability across a broad pH range (pH 2–11) and resistance to photobleaching.

Heparin calcium (MW 15000-19000)
Nadroparin calcium (MW 15000-19000)
T86568
Heparin calcium (MW 15000-19000), an anticoagulant, forms a reversible complex with antithrombin III (ATIII), known as the heparin-antithrombin III complex. This complex binds to thrombin and the activated clotting factors IX, X, XI, and XII, leading to their irreversible inactivation and inhibiting the conversion of fibrinogen into fibrin [1] [2].

Poly-D-lysine hydrobromide (MW 150000-300000)
PDLHB (MW 150000-300000), 27964-99-4
TCL-01090
Poly-D-lysine hydrobromide (MW 150000-300000), is a synthetic polymeric substrate widely used in neural cell culture to enhance cell adhesion. Poly-D-lysine hydrobromide additionally functions as a calcium-sensing receptor (CaSR) agonist peptide, broadening its relevance in both cell biology and neurobiological research applications.
